Hi all,

This might be very stupid .... and i don't think its feasible ... but still want to know for sure.

Suppose my device is not BES activated, can we invoke an api or use any other way, to uninstall the application on the device remotely. I know it can be done through BES if the device is activated. Even if we can wipe the device ... its OK. Basically the user should not have access to the application after the action takes place.

Please don't mind if this is one of most silly questions on the forum ... I had to confirm before i can say so to my boss.

Hi,
unless you yourself were the developer and had written some sort of 'bullet' or something to tell the application to update itself with new empty modules, without it being on the BES, there's no way I know of to have an application removed remotely. (short of asking the remote user to go to options -> advanced options -> applications and removing the app manually)
